Champions at home to Dragons on tomorrow night
Devin Toner will captain defending champions Leinster in their Guinness PRO14 clash with Dragons at the RDS tomorrow night.
He's joined in the second-row by academy lock Ryan Baird, who gets his first start for the province.
Out-half Harry Byrne also starts for the first time while prop Jack Aungier could make his debut from the bench.
